The Thrilling World of Racing Games: An Expert Overview

Racing games, at their core, simulate the experience of competitive vehicle racing. However, this simple definition belies a genre of remarkable depth and diversity. From hyper-realistic simulations that demand precise control and strategic pit stops to over-the-top arcade racers where gravity is merely a suggestion, racing games cater to a wide spectrum of tastes and skill levels.

The genre’s evolution is a fascinating journey through gaming history. Early titles like Space Race (1973) and Gran Trak 10 (1974) laid the foundation, using simple graphics and rudimentary controls. The arcade boom of the 1980s brought classics like Pole Position and Out Run, introducing more sophisticated gameplay and a greater sense of speed. The advent of 3D graphics in the 1990s revolutionized the genre, paving the way for landmark titles like Ridge Racer and Gran Turismo, which pushed the boundaries of realism and immersion.

Today, racing games are a multi-billion dollar industry, encompassing everything from console and PC games to mobile titles and eSports competitions. The genre continues to evolve, with developers constantly pushing the limits of technology to create ever more realistic and engaging experiences. Recent trends include the rise of open-world racing games, the increasing popularity of online multiplayer, and the integration of virtual reality (VR) technology.

Unleashing the Power: Key Features of the Simagic Alpha Mini Wheelbase

The Simagic Alpha Mini Wheelbase is a prime example of Simagic’s commitment to quality and performance. It’s a compact yet powerful direct drive wheelbase designed to deliver a realistic and immersive sim racing experience. Here’s a breakdown of its key features:

  • Direct Drive Technology: Unlike gear-driven or belt-driven wheelbases, the Alpha Mini uses a direct drive motor, which means the steering wheel is directly connected to the motor shaft. This eliminates any lag or play, resulting in incredibly precise and responsive force feedback. The user benefit is a more realistic and engaging driving experience, allowing you to feel every detail of the track and the car’s behavior.
  • High Torque Output: Despite its compact size, the Alpha Mini delivers up to 10 Nm of torque, providing ample force feedback for even the most demanding racing simulations. This allows you to feel the weight of the car, the grip of the tires, and the impact of collisions. Our extensive testing shows that this torque level provides a great balance between realism and usability for most sim racers.
  • Compact and Lightweight Design: The Alpha Mini’s small footprint makes it ideal for users with limited space. Its lightweight design also makes it easy to mount and adjust. The benefit here is increased flexibility and compatibility with a wider range of sim racing setups.
  • Customizable Force Feedback Settings: The Alpha Mini offers a wide range of customizable force feedback settings, allowing you to fine-tune the driving experience to your preferences. You can adjust parameters such as overall strength, damping, friction, and inertia. This level of customization allows you to create a truly personalized and immersive driving experience.
  • Quick Release System: The Alpha Mini features a quick release system that allows you to easily swap steering wheels. This is particularly useful for users who own multiple steering wheels for different types of racing. This adds convenience and versatility to your sim racing setup.
  • High Refresh Rate: The Alpha Mini boasts a high refresh rate, ensuring that force feedback is delivered smoothly and without any noticeable lag. This is crucial for maintaining a realistic and immersive driving experience.
  • Advanced Software Suite: Simagic provides a comprehensive software suite that allows you to configure and monitor the Alpha Mini. The software also includes a range of pre-set profiles for popular racing games, making it easy to get started.

The Simagic Alpha Mini: A Detailed and Trustworthy Review

The Simagic Alpha Mini wheelbase aims to deliver a premium direct drive experience in a compact package. After extensive testing and evaluation, here’s a comprehensive review:

User Experience & Usability: Setting up the Alpha Mini is straightforward, especially with Simagic’s user-friendly software. The quick-release system makes wheel changes a breeze. The compact size is a boon for smaller spaces. In our experience, the initial setup takes about 30 minutes, and the software is intuitive enough for both beginners and experienced sim racers.

Performance & Effectiveness: The Alpha Mini delivers impressive force feedback for its size. The direct drive system provides a noticeable improvement in responsiveness and detail compared to belt-driven wheels. We tested it with a variety of racing games, from Assetto Corsa to iRacing, and it performed admirably in all scenarios. The 10Nm of torque is sufficient for most users, providing a strong sense of connection to the car and the track.

Pros:

  • Excellent Force Feedback: The direct drive system provides detailed and responsive force feedback, enhancing immersion and control.
  • Compact Size: The small footprint makes it ideal for users with limited space.
  • High Build Quality: The Alpha Mini is built to last, with high-quality materials and robust construction.
  • Easy to Use Software: Simagic’s software is user-friendly and provides a wide range of customization options.
  • Quick Release System: The quick release system makes it easy to swap steering wheels.

Cons/Limitations:

  • Torque Limit: While 10Nm is sufficient for most users, some may prefer a wheelbase with higher torque output.
  • Price: The Alpha Mini is a premium product, and its price reflects that.
  • Limited Compatibility: While compatible with most PC racing games, console compatibility is limited (requires additional adapters).
  • No Included Steering Wheel: The wheelbase is sold separately from the steering wheel, which adds to the overall cost.

Ideal User Profile: The Simagic Alpha Mini is best suited for serious sim racers who are looking for a high-quality direct drive wheelbase in a compact and affordable package. It’s a great option for those who want to upgrade from a belt-driven wheel or who are just getting started with sim racing and want to invest in a high-quality piece of equipment.

Key Alternatives: The Fanatec CSL DD and Moza R5 are two popular alternatives to the Simagic Alpha Mini. The CSL DD offers a similar level of performance at a slightly lower price point, while the Moza R5 is a more compact and budget-friendly option.
